Most roof failures don't happen overnight — they build quietly for months before a homeowner notices the ceiling stain that finally forces the issue.
Heavy granule loss is one of the earliest visible clues that a roof is approaching the end of its service life.
Cupped shingles trap moisture underneath instead of shedding it, accelerating rot in the decking below.
Visible light through the roof deck is a direct sign the barrier between your attic and the weather has been compromised.
Sagging drywall or a soft spot underfoot in the attic usually points to sustained moisture damage, not a one-time drip.
Energy bills that creep upward without an obvious reason are worth checking against your roof's condition.
Even one missing shingle can let enough water through to rot the decking underneath within a single storm season.
